Basic Information

Regular Relationship :


Phenotype/DiseaseSpecie

Hepatocellular Carcinoma

CeRNA1

CCAT1[LncRNA]

miRNA

miR-181a-5p[miRNA]

CeRNA2

ATG7[mRNA]


Tissue/Cell line

The human HCC cell lines (HCCLM3, Huh7, Hep3B, andHepG2) and a hepatocyte cell line (L02)

Specie

Homo sapiens (human)

Citation

J Cell Biochem 2019 Oct 120, 17975-17983 doi:10.1002/jcb.29064 PMID:31218739


Reference title
LncRNA CCAT1 promotes autophagy via regulating ATG7 by sponging miR-181 in hepatocellular carcinoma
Experimental verification
Western blot,RT-PCR,Luciferase reporter assay etc.

Functional description
Our findings indicate CCAT1 may play a role in regulatingautophagy by sponging miR-181a-5p in HCC.
